Legal Changes Impacting Property Investors

The property market in the UK is subject to various legal changes that can impact property investors. For example, the Renters Reform Bill is set to introduce new regulations that may affect landlords and tenants alike. Staying informed about these legal changes is essential for property investors to navigate the market effectively and mitigate any potential risks.

Best Places to Invest in Property in the UK

1. Birmingham

   - Average property price: £207,100

   - Average rent: £1,275 per month

   - Average rental yield: 5.5%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have risen by 2.7%

2. Manchester

   - Average property price: £220,000

   - Average rent: £1,300 per month

   - Average rental yield: 6.25%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have increased by 2.3%

3. Glasgow

   - Average property price: £142,800

   - Average rent: £1,200 per month

   - Average rental yield: 6.56%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have risen by 0.3%

4. Liverpool

   - Average property price: £155,700

   - Average rent: £965 per month

   - Average rental yield: 6.7%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have increased by 1.8%

5. Leeds

   - Average property price: £210,000

   - Average rent: £1,120 per month

   - Average rental yield: 4.8%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have risen by 2.3%

6. Newcastle

   - Average property price: £150,000

   - Average rent: £1,140 per month

   - Average rental yield: 5.7%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have risen by 2.1%

7. Nottingham

   - Average property price: £202,500

   - Average rent: £1,030 per month

   - Average rental yield: 2.9%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have increased by 2.9%

8. Bradford

   - Average property price: £186,000

   - Average rent: £670 per month

   - Average rental yield: 4.7%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have dropped by 2%

9. Hull

   - Average property price: £143,000

   - Average rent: £650 per month

   - Average rental yield: 4%

   - Price movement (last year): Prices have decreased by 3%

10. Leicester

    - Average property price: £227,600

    - Average rent: £1,075 per month

    - Average rental yield: 8.2%

    - Price movement (last year): Prices have risen by 1.5%

Worst Places to Invest in Property in the UK

While there are many lucrative opportunities for property investment in the UK, some areas may not offer the same financial benefits. Locations like Southend-on-Sea, Blackpool, Wolverhampton, Sunderland, and Stoke-on-Trent are suggested to be approached with caution due to various challenges in economic development and limited growth potential.
